THE BEE CAUSE PROJECT INC, founded in 2013, is a small nonprofit in the Education sector that reported $494K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ue decreased 8% compared to the prior year.

Mission

OUR OBSERVATIONAL HIVES, STEAM CURRICULUM, AND BEEKEEPING RESOURCES STRENGHTEN THE CONNECTION TO OUR SHARED ENVIRONMENT WITH POLLINATORS AND ENABLE BEES AND CURIOUS MINDS ALIKE TO THRIVE.
